- Pakistan Initiates Second Sunset Review of Anti-Dumping Duties on PVC Resin from China, South Korea, Thailand, and Taiwan
The National Tariff Commission of Pakistan announced the launch of a second sunset review investigation (Case No. 50/2016/NTC/PVC/SR-II/2025) on suspension-grade polyvinyl chloride (PVC) resin imported from China, South Korea, Thailand, and Taiwan. The investigation, prompted by a petition from domestic producer Engro Polymer and Chemicals Limited, covers the period from January 1, 2022, to December 31, 2024. The product, classified under HS code 3904.1090, is primarily used in manufacturing pipes, garden hoses, footwear, cables, films, and packaging materials. Existing anti-dumping duties will remain effective during the review, with a final ruling expected within 12 months.
- Vita Group Unveils Orbis Ultra Foam with Over 95% Recycled Content
Vita Group, a European leader in flexible polyurethane foam solutions, announced a breakthrough in its 2024 Sustainability Report. Its Orbis Ultra foam incorporates 100% recycled polyols and 100% recycled TDI (derived from recycled TDA), achieving over 95% post-consumer recycled content from end-of-life foam. This innovation marks a milestone in circular economy solutions for the polyurethane industry.

- Sibur hikes 2030 recycling, sustainable plastics capacity goals
Sibur Holding PJSC (Moscow), Russia's largest producer of polymers and synthetic rubber, has hiked its targets for the recycling of waste plastics and the use of bio-based and low-carbon polymers as part of its updated sustainability strategy to 2030.

- Teijin’s Recycled Twaron® Powers Bridgestone’s Solar Racing Tires
Teijin Aramid’s Twaron® para-aramid fiber, containing recycled content, will reinforce Bridgestone tires for the 2025 World Solar Challenge. This marks the first use of circular Twaron® in high-performance racing tires, maintaining strength while advancing sustainability.

1. Rare Earth Crisis: Indian Auto Industry Urges Government to Engage China
Multiple Indian suppliers have applied for rare earth export permits through their Chinese partners, but no approvals have been granted so far. Due to shortages of rare earth magnets, Indian automakers may suspend electric vehicle (EV) production, potentially delaying new EV deliveries. Rakesh Sharma, Executive Director of Bajaj Auto, stated that supplies and inventories are gradually depleting, and production could face severe disruptions by July if the situation remains unresolved.

4. UK Employment Sees Sharpest Drop Since 2020 as Wage Growth Slows
The UK labor market continued to cool amid higher hiring costs, with employment falling sharply and wage growth hitting a seven-month low. According to the UK Office for National Statistics, wage growth excluding bonuses slowed to 5.2% in the three months to April, below economists’ 5.3% forecast. Private sector wage growth—a key metric for the Bank of England—declined from 5.5% to 5.1%.
5. Traders Boost Bets on Bank of England Rate Cuts Ahead of German Bond Auction
European government bonds opened largely flat. The yield on 2-year German government bonds remained flat at 1.87%, while 10-year and 30-year yields dipped 1 basis point to 2.56% and 3%, respectively. Markets await Germany’s 2030 bond auction and comments from European Central Bank officials François Villeroy de Galhau and Olli Rehn. Traders now price in 45 basis points of Bank of England rate cuts by year-end, up from 41 basis points earlier, following weak UK employment and wage data.
